Practical Brand Designer Notes You Can’t Skip
Before locking it into your next client project or small business branding rollout, run these checks:
- Test it on real packaging mockups—not just digital previews—to assess scale and balance
- Check black-and-white usage: does the outline hold up in single-color print (like stamping or embossing)?
- Preview it on small labels (1" x 1.5")—does legibility hold?
- Test it beside your brand colors: does it harmonize with your palette, or clash with secondary hues?
- Compare it with competitor packaging—does it stand out *distinctly*, or blend in?
- Review PNG transparency: clean edges matter for stickers and overlays
- Inspect SVG editability: can you easily adjust stroke weight or isolate elements for custom tweaks?
- Test typography pairings—try it beside serif, sans serif, script, handwritten, and display fonts to see which best supports your voice
- Confirm commercial license: this is non-negotiable for physical product sales, client work, or any commercial design use
